Gas gauge, its being worthless

well my gas gauge is acting up pretty bad. well i dont know if it really is the gauge but something related. after i fill my tank up, about 22 dollars and about 10 and a half gallons, i drive for maybe 2 or 3 days just about 4 or 5 miles each day and bam its already towards E. so im thinking there is a bad connection or a loose wire, something of that nature. anybody have a similar problem or a solution?

Sounds like a sending unit. Find the wire(s) leading to your sending unit and unplug the wire(s). Now ground the circuit. Your gas gauge should go full (or empty depending on the circuit). Generally speaking, if your gauge is capable of making a full sweep, then your looking at wiring or a sending unit. I'd put money on the sending unit. Over time gasoline can corrode and/or deteriorate the conducting surfaces of the sending unit.

One other thing comes to mind... How is your gas tank? Have you smashed it into anything recently? Hearing any weird noises coming from it?

fuel tank sending unit.

My sending unit went about 2 years ago. I got one new for $145 from the dealer. I installed it by myself, it would help to have another set of hands when removing and when installing the tank! NOT a fun task, if you do need to replace it buy a new one, for what a used one will run you and the odds that its in the same shape as your current one why waste the time! Just my .02!~
